The Transfer Credit Evaluator is primarily responsible for conducting evaluations for courses completed at other institutions to fulfill Regent University degree requirements. Transfer credit evaluators will ensure that accurate and timely evaluation of eligible credit is performed at all academic levels. This position is expected to demonstrate professionalism and extraordinary service and communication to students at Regent University.

Work Location: Virginia Beach, VA 

Essential duties:

  • Research and evaluate course equivalencies utilizing the TES evaluation system and other resources to accurately and excellently complete transfer credit and advanced standing evaluations.
  • Develop and maintain comprehensive knowledge and resources on all undergraduate, graduate and doctoral programs and effectively apply school transfer policies when evaluating transfer credit and advanced standing requests.
  • Perform transfer credit related data entries within student academic record systems, including Banner, with a high level of accuracy.
  • Maintain currency for all transfer credit equivalency databases and student-related resources.
  • Provide exceptional customer service to all incoming, current, and previous students of Regent University through professional conversations made by phone, email, chat, and face-to-face.
